Academic Overview
Shepherd University is a private (not-for-profit), four-years institute located in Los Angeles, California. The highest degree offered by Shepherd University is Doctor's degree - professional practice.
The 2024 tuition & fees is $19,399 for undergraduate students. The graduate school tuition & fees is $14,033.
The school offers both undergraduate and graduate programs and a total of 257 students are enrolled.
